Preston, a talented individual, hailed from the picturesque suburb of Morningside, Auckland, New Zealand, a place that has gained fame through the popular television show, BroTown. Despite not starting his acting career until his mid-thirties, Preston has made a significant impact in the industry.
His theatrical debut was a notable one, as he took to the stage for the production of 'The Smell of Rain', which was part of the prestigious Short&Sweet theatre competition. The play, which showcased Preston's exceptional talent, went on to win an impressive three awards, solidifying his position as a rising star in the world of theatre.
Preston's first feature film was 'Crackheads', a testament to his versatility and dedication to his craft.
